Ahh there is still life in this echo.  Speaking about winter, I am nearing
the end of my OEM Michelins for my FORD Escape and looking into something
more agressive for the Cape Cod winters.   I've narrowed it down to two tires
that seem to be reasonably priced i.e. Firestone Destination A/T and General
Grabbers AT2.  It seems that both are favorites in the reviews, both offer
all around performance and longetivity and both have good reputations for not
being loud. What it seems to boil down to in the reviews is what vehical they
were on.The Grabbers seem a tad bit better in the snow but everyone raves
about how long the Firestones last. The reviews tend to get hair splitting. 
A third newcomer is the Yokohama Geolander (too many choices). Anyhow, I do a
lot of mixed driving being a visiting nurse in a rural area so I run up
against sand at beachfront properties, mud and dirt roads, and occasional
torrential flooding in areas. I am leaning towards the Firestones. Any other
ideas out there?
